The official closing band on Saturday at FPSF was the Postal Service, but for those of us who know how much even mellow indie-rock like the fare played by Ben Gibbard et al. owes to Detroit madman Iggy Pop, he and his Stooges were the climax of the day's events.
A crowd gathered around the Neptune Stage to pay tribute to the grandfather of punk and as soon as he stepped onto the stage, we went through a time machine. Though he looked his generation, his voice told a different story, screeching out just as powerfully and dangerously as it had 40 years earlier. [Houston Press]
Houston's Free Press Summer Festival kicked off yesterday (6/1) with sets from The Postal Service, Arctic Monkeys, Passion Pit, Iggy & The Stooges, Alabama Shakes, A Place to Bury Strangers and more. Pictures of those (and other) bands are in this post.
Arctic Monkeys have been playing a new song, "Do I Wanna Know?," at their recent shows, and if you haven't checked that out yet, you can watch a video of them debuting it in California last month, along with more FPSF pictures, below...
